  • Isaac Comer‍ when you move to hosted, be sure to ask to move to "Cloud Hosting" (which is powered by Azure instead of Boston / Orange County / Vancouver traditional hosting sites) if you are in cloud hosting, you will be using Microsoft Office Professional Plus 2016. If you are in other versions of hosting, I think it is still a much older version of Office.

  • Isaac Comer‍ We moved to BB hosting in December of 2018.  We were scared to death, but other than a few months of Queue not working (oy) it's actually been really, really smooth.  We were set up in the Cloud Hosting/Azure server environment that Graham Getty‍ mentioned.  


    All of our exports and mail merges have worked remarkably well, AddressAccelerator is lightning fast (compared to our previous local setup) and I can't think of single moment of real downtime.  We had a few issues getting the proper version of Citrix working, but those were mostly local rights and security issues on our PCs, not anything Blackbaud could control.
